"Although road-rail competition has been the subject of a number of books nearly all concentrate on descriptions of the means of control used in a particular country. Professor Kolsen makes comparison of types of controls used in three different countries with interesting results. These show that that the methods used in any particular country are not the only, or necessarily the best, means for achieving a given end.
